The Feather as a Symbol of Fate and Destiny

One of the primary interpretations of the feather in Forrest Gump is its representation of fate and destiny. From the very beginning of the film, we see the feather floating effortlessly, carried by the wind, eventually landing at Forrest’s feet. This feather acts as a metaphor for how life’s circumstances often seem to be guided by forces beyond our control. It emphasizes the idea that certain events are predestined or fated to happen, regardless of our own actions or choices.

This concept of fate becomes particularly evident when we consider the life journey of the protagonist, Forrest Gump. Despite his intellectual limitations, Forrest manages to find himself in extraordinary situations, such as becoming a football star, a war hero, and a successful businessman. The feather serves as a constant reminder that Forrest’s life is not solely determined by his own decisions but is shaped by external forces beyond his comprehension.

Moreover, the feather also mirrors the unpredictable nature of life itself. Just as the feather moves aimlessly through the wind, ending up in unexpected places, so too does Forrest find himself in unexpected circumstances. This symbolism adds depth to the narrative by highlighting the randomness and unpredictability of life, reminding us that our destinies are often shaped by chance encounters and unforeseen events.

The Feather as a Symbol of Innocence and Purity

Another key interpretation of the feather in Forrest Gump is its representation of innocence and purity. Throughout the film, Forrest remains an innocent and naïve character, largely shielded from the complexities and harsh realities of the world. The feather acts as a visual reminder of Forrest’s childlike nature, carrying a sense of purity and untainted simplicity.

Forrest’s innocence is further exemplified by his unwavering trust in others and his genuine kindness towards everyone he encounters. Despite facing challenges and adversity, he maintains a pure heart, always seeing the best in people and situations. The feather serves as a symbol of this purity, reminding us of Forrest’s inherent goodness and his ability to navigate the world with wide-eyed wonder.

Furthermore, the feather also represents the purity of love and relationships. In one poignant scene, Forrest keeps the feather inside his copy of Curious George, a book given to him by Jenny, his lifelong friend and love interest. This act symbolizes how the feather becomes a cherished memento of their connection, representing their pure and genuine bond.

The Feather as a Symbol of Hope and Serendipity

Lastly, the feather in Forrest Gump symbolizes hope and serendipity. Throughout the film, Forrest faces numerous challenges, both personally and globally, such as the Vietnam War and the struggles of his loved ones. Yet, despite these hardships, the feather serves as a constant reminder of the power of hope and the possibility of unexpected joys.

When the feather first appears, it brings a sense of wonder and intrigue, captivating both Forrest and the audience. This sense of wonder extends throughout the film, acting as a beacon of hope in the face of adversity. The feather reminds us that even amidst chaos and uncertainty, there is always the potential for beauty and serendipitous moments.

Additionally, the feather also represents the interconnectedness of humanity. As it floats through the air, the feather encounters various individuals, briefly touching their lives before moving on. This symbolism suggests that we are all connected in some way, and that every person we encounter has the potential to impact our lives, no matter how fleeting or insignificant the interaction may seem.
